French Jihadist Killed in Strasbourg Raps

Jérémie Louis-Sidney, 33, alleged ringleader of a jihadist cell in France, was killed after a gunfight with French police in Strasbourg on October 6. Louis-Sidney was wanted in connection with a terror attack on a Jewish shop on September 19 in Sarcelles where a grenade was thrown into the shop wounding one. When the police came to arrest him, Louis-Sidney the police say he opened fire with a .357 magnum wounding one officer. Louis-Sidney's mother and wife have filed a complaint alleging "voluntary homicide" by the police. On the same day that Louis-Sidney was killed, 11 other suspected terrorists were rounded up around the country, suspected as being part of the cell of which Louis-Sidney was claimed to be the ringleader. Louis-Sidney had performed with several rap groups in the past. In this clip he says, among other things, "September 11 is just the tip of the iceberg."
